Output 13b7164c162e3dab962523b5169b008ee41f3344b454a220d4a05b50d0e49359:12

value
8598402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8391c7bb98702cf4fd17ea238b3f544a9171268 OP_EQUAL
address
MWXeEAUmfQgXRqg43CRPaF3sKZT17imzu9
transaction
13b7164c162e3dab962523b5169b008ee41f3344b454a220d4a05b50d0e49359
spent
true